Optimizing Readability in Fast-Scrolling Feeds
One of the biggest concerns when choosing a handwritten font for marketing campaigns is readability. Will the audience actually read the message? With Harvey Jackson, the answer is yes, provided you use it strategically. The key lies in understanding visual hierarchy. This font is best suited for short headlines, callouts, and display text rather than long paragraphs of body copy.
When designing for mobile screens, I keep the text size generous. The uneven strokes of the script amp can become cluttered if scaled down too much. However, on larger displays or within a thumbnail context, the details shine. For dark backgrounds, the white or light variations of the font pop with high contrast, ensuring the message is clear. Conversely, on light backgrounds, a darker shade provides a grounded, solid look that anchors the design.
To maintain message clarity, I pair Harvey Jackson with a clean sans serif font for supporting text. This modern typography system creates a perfect balance: the script captures attention, while the clean secondary font delivers the details without confusion. This combination ensures that your audience gets the full story quickly, which is crucial for effective communication in digital ads and social posts.
